4 Disallowance Nineteenth Century Background Confederation: John A. Macdonald Gradually a different colonial system is being developed – and will become, year by year, less a case of dependence on our part, and of over-ruling protection on the part of the Mother Country, and more a case of healthy and cordial alliance. Instead of looking upon us as a merely dependent colony, England will have in us a friendly nation – a subordinate but still a powerful people – to stand by her in North America in peace or in war. A Self-Governing Colony

5 Major Cause of Confederation: fear of the United States Nineteenth Century Background

6 Major Cause of Confederation : fear of the United States Somewhere on Parliament Hill… there should be erected a monument to this American ogre who has so often performed the function of saving us from drift and indecision. Frank Underhill University of Toronto Nineteenth Century Background
